Background technology
Epochmaking " foot " color that the biped of the mankind is played the part of in life, such as walk, run, jump, play, step on, across, the action such as jump, except the neural coordination of needs coordinates with muscle contraction, also need foot bones do support just be accomplished, with regard to single with regard to walking, foot will face the impact load of about health body weight 3 ~ 5 times, common people on average walk 8,000 steps every day, foot just must bear the ground reaction force of 1440 tonnes for one day, these excessive pressure are the main causes causing foot to injure, and foot is the foundation part of health, as gone wrong, Foot-biomechanics is caused to change, the overall health that gets off for a long time all can be affected, more serious concerning problem the people needing to stand for a long time or often walk.
Foot has a curved position to be called arch of foot at sole middle section position, this curved position is just as the spring of sole, to help when absorbing walking heelstrike and stressed caused concussion, the transfer of center of gravity and earth surface when carrying out standing or walking, increase the elastic force of foot and produce the balance of health, foot pathological changes problem just often betides arch of foot, no matter if bypass inborn bone growth, excessive pressure and posture improperly easily cause arch of foot bend position make a variation, and bow position mutation mainly contains two kinds: bend position too low (i.e. flat foot) and bend position too high (i.e. pes cavus);
Flat foot is stage casing fallen arches inside sole, nut bone is given prominence to, strephexopodia after flat foot more easily makes foot derivative, middle joints of foot overrelaxation, tibia inward turning, more can be unbalance because of the foundation of body-support, and then make health other parts generation problem, basin bone is such as caused to lean forward, increase the situation that lumbar vertebra is antecurvature, more easily more tired than normal person during patient's walking, vola, easily there is pain in shank and knee, and pes cavus to be the bow position of sole too high, this kind of foot joint can be more stiff, then the ability of ball absorption concussion is lowered, the bow too high long-range meeting in position makes knee joint bear larger pressure, cause knee-joint pain, particularly anterior position, and the camber excessive pressurized of vola front end and rear end that also easily causes in vola becomes large, foot is caused easily to ache tired defect.
Correct the symptom of flat foot or pes cavus, traditional mode is treated by surgical operation, but due to corrective procedure, must to move muscle deep, the convalescence after Miles operation is very long again, so just developed a kind of rectification footwear and shoe pad afterwards, with footwear or shoe pad positioning supports foot, the gentle means of adjustment ambulatory status alleviate foot pressure and correct, with the shoe pad corrected, " shoe pad of ergonomics is met " just like No. M325753, TaiWan, China patent announcement, its structure is generally with the body that a length is equal with foot, the first teat is formed on body, second teat, 3rd teat, recess, wherein the first teat, second teat, 3rd teat corresponds respectively to foot medial arch district, crossbows district, bow district, outside, foot palm surface is coordinated to become gradual overshooting shape, and recess corresponds to heel, heel face is coordinated to become gradual recess, to possess enough laminating supporting degrees, form the shoe pad that meets human foot engineering completely,
Although aforementioned shoe pad can be fitted in sole in theory, the arch of foot in outside is to provide suitable support, reach and arch of foot is located and the effect of disperseing foot pressure really, but in fact, single with regard to normal person, the height slightly difference of everyone arch of foot bow position, highly then there is obvious gap the bow position suffering from the people of bow position mutation, sometimes, the bow position of pes cavus patient and flat foot patient highly even gap to about 2 centimeters, and in order to corresponding foot medial arch district on this kind of shoe pad, crossbows district, first teat in bow district, outside, second teat, 3rd teat, its thickness and area are also shaped when making shoe pad thereupon, but buy the user of same size shoe pad, the height of its bow position, the degree of foot deformities or the position of pressure inequality vary with each individual, so when reality uses, on shoe pad first, second does not often have complete with corresponding arch of foot position to contact with the 3rd teat and leaves gap, cause shoe pad positively cannot locate arch of foot and give good support in ambulatory status, only has decompression shock-absorbing effect slightly at most.
As can be seen here, this kind directly forms the quantification formula shoe pad of corresponding arch of foot design on surface, its position cannot bending the height of position, the degree of foot deformities or pressure inequality for different users individually supports, and do not provide solution to vola camber is excessive, therefore rectification effect is faint, aobvious have the necessity improved.

Detailed description of the invention
The invention relates to the shoe pad of a kind of tool vola decompression, please first consult shown in Fig. 1 to Fig. 3, it is the illustration of first embodiment of the invention, comprises in the present embodiment:
One pad 1 being mounted on footwear body inside, in foot inner edge, corresponding arch of foot position has one first holding part 10 to this pad 1, an impact bag 20 is then installed with in this holding part 10, this pad 1 has one second holding part 11 in position, central authorities corresponding vola again, this second holding part 11 is provided with a bracketing capsule 21, fluid 22 is contained in this impact bag 20 and this bracketing capsule 21, in the present embodiment, in utricule except being filled with fluid 22, still include gas 23, the ratio that adjustable utricule inner fluid 22 and gas 23 mix, changes thickness and the soft durometer of utricule whereby.And a supplementary pipe 24 is provided with in impact bag 20 surface, in this supplementary pipe 24, there is a check valve 241, with this supplementary pipe 24 inner fluid 22 of impact bag 20 or gas 23 as a supplement, make the ratio that the fluid 22 in utricule and gas 23 adjustable mix, change thickness and the soft durometer (i.e. saturation) of impact bag 20 whereby, and prevent oil gas from leaking with check valve 241, therefore the bow position height adjustment impact bag 20 of the visual different arch of foot of this pad 1, make arch of foot correctly locate whereby and provide the vola of different camber suitable support force with bracketing capsule 21, to discharge foot pressure and to reduce foot injury and pathological changes.
And this impact bag 20 and this bracketing capsule 21 for straight forming or indirectly bonding mode arbitrary or both combination and be arranged on pad 1, shown in comparison chart 3 and Fig. 4, Fig. 5, Fig. 3 illustrates that this impact bag 20 is arranged at pad 1 to be directly molded on the first holding part 10 mode, and 21, this bracketing capsule is arranged at pad 1 to be indirectly bonding on the second holding part 11 mode; This impact bag 20 and this bracketing capsule 21 are then adopted and are indirectly bonding on first, second holding part 10,11 mode and are arranged at pad 1 by Fig. 4, Fig. 5 respectively, and adopt the utricule indirectly binded and have more the advantage upgrading and replace.
Continue and please coordinate with reference to shown in Fig. 6 to Fig. 9, these figure are the illustration of second embodiment of the invention, in the present embodiment, pad 1 is except having the impact bag 20 and bracketing capsule 21 originally adopting and indirectly bind, a suitable sufficient air bag 3 has still been installed with in it, this suitable sufficient air bag 3 corresponding pad 1 front end has a half sole air bag 30, opposite rear end then has a heel air bag 31, this half sole air bag 30 and this heel air bag 31 are connected with each other with a breather 32, known with reference to Fig. 9, this breather 32 connects half sole air bag 30 and heel air bag 31 below bracketing capsule 21;
Furthermore, in the heel air bag 31 of this suitable sufficient air bag 3, there is a charge valve 33, surface is then provided with a suction nozzle 34, this suction nozzle 34 mouth of pipe is exposed to outside pad 1, when thinking that this suitable sufficient air bag 3 air pressure inside is not enough, charge valve 33 can be pressed by outside suction gas 23 by trample action with heel, and by this breather 32, gas 23 be sent into half sole air bag 30 by heel air bag 31, to supplement the buffering vibration-absorbing function that suitable sufficient air bag 3 air pressure inside recovers suitable sufficient air bag 3;
And the half sole air bag 30 of this suitable sufficient air bag 3 is divided into several pipe capsule 301, be three pipe capsules 301 in the present embodiment, those pipe capsules 301 are laterally distributed, namely the longitudinal axis of relatively suitable sufficient air bag 3 forms horizontally set, slightly leave interval between each pipe capsule 301, and be connected with a conduit 302, so design the pressure dispersibled bottom forefoot, and between walking, give the massage of sole appropriateness, delay the generation of sole fatigue.
With reference to shown in Fig. 7 to Fig. 9, effect of the present invention is as follows:
One, the position that visual different users bends the height of position, the degree of foot deformities or plantar pressure inequality adjusts fluid 22 and gas 23 mixed proportion of this impact bag 20 and bracketing capsule 21 inside, such as, when fluid 22 is more than gas 23, this impact bag 20 and bracketing capsule 21 softer, comparatively comfortable when contacting with arch of foot, gas 23, more than then contrary during fluid 22, contacts comparatively sturdy with arch of foot; When fluid 22 and gas 23 being filled up impact bag 20 inside, this impact bag 20 is comparatively full, can provide the support force that arch of foot is good, and when impact bag 20 internal reservation space is more, then have preferably resiliency.
Two, after pad 1 uses a period of time, or use through arch of foot through rectification during Level Change, fluid 22 or gas 23 can be filled up to impact bag 20 inside by supplementing pipe 24, make impact bag 20 recover fluid 22 or the gas 23 of volatilization, and the arch height after making impact bag 20 can cater to user rectification give suitable support.
